Price List Analysis
General Price Ranges in New York
According to Sidecar Health, the average cost of breast - related surgeries in New York can give us a general idea of what to expect for breast pore shrinking surgery. For breast reduction in New York, the average outpatient hospital price is $10,439 and the average surgery center price is $6,051.
Rockmore Plastic Surgery in the Albany area provides some specific price ranges for various plastic surgeries. Although breast pore shrinking surgery is not explicitly mentioned, breast - related procedures can give a reference:
Procedure | Price Range |
---|---|
Breast Augmentation | $8,600 to $8,800 |
Breast Augmentation Revision | $8,600 to $9,500 |
Breast Lift | $9,000 to $12,000 |
Breast Reduction | $9,500 to $11,000 |
It's important to note that these are just estimates, and the actual cost of breast pore shrinking surgery can vary depending on multiple factors.
Factors Affecting the Price
- Surgeon's Expertise: Highly experienced and well - known surgeons may charge more for their services. For example, a surgeon with a long history of successful breast surgeries and positive patient reviews is likely to have a higher fee.
- Hospital Facilities: Hospitals with state - of - the - art equipment and luxurious facilities may have higher costs associated with the surgery. For instance, a hospital with advanced imaging technology and comfortable patient recovery areas may charge more.
- Complexity of the Procedure: If the breast pore shrinking surgery is more complex, such as in cases where there are underlying skin conditions or a large number of pores to be treated, the price will be higher.
- Geographical Location: Albany's cost of living and local market competition can also impact the price. If there are more plastic surgery providers in the area, there may be more price competition.
Preparing for Breast Pore Shrinking Surgery
Medical Considerations
Before undergoing breast pore shrinking surgery, patients need to have a thorough medical evaluation. This includes a physical examination to assess the overall health of the patient, as well as a detailed examination of the breasts to determine the best approach for the surgery. Patients may also need to undergo mammograms, especially if they are over 40 years old, to rule out any underlying breast conditions.
It's also important for patients to disclose their medical history, including any pre - existing medical conditions such as diabetes, high blood pressure, or heart disease. This information helps the surgeon to develop a safe and effective surgical plan.
Lifestyle Changes
Patients are often advised to make certain lifestyle changes before surgery. Smoking should be stopped at least six weeks before the procedure, as smoking can impede the healing process and increase the risk of complications. Patients should also try to achieve and maintain a healthy weight, as weight fluctuations after surgery can affect the results.
